Hamilton Technology Yield Systematic Risk

Hamilton Technology's systematic risk plays a vital role in portfolio allocation when considering its stock to be added to a well-diversified portfolio. Hamilton Technology volatility which cannot be eliminated through diversification, requires returns over the risk-free rate. Over the long run, a well-diversified portfolio provides returns that match its exposure to systematic risk. In this case, investors face a trade-off between expected returns and systematic risk and, therefore, can only reduce a portfolio's exposure to systematic risk by sacrificing expected returns on the portfolio.

The Beta measures systematic risk based on how returns on Hamilton Technology Yield correlated with the market. If Beta is less than 0 Hamilton Technology generally moves in the opposite direction as compared to the market. If Hamilton Technology Beta is about zero movement of price series is uncorrelated with the movement of the benchmark. if Beta is between zero and one Hamilton Technology Yield is generally moves in the same direction as, but less than the movement of the market. For Beta = 1 movement of Hamilton Technology is generally in the same direction as the market. If Beta > 1 Hamilton Technology moves generally in the same direction as, but more than the movement of the benchmark.
